Plumbing Blow-Out

We use high-volume air to clear all underground lines of water, preventing freeze damage in the Las Vegas off-season.

Anti-Freeze & Plugging

Installation of winter plugs and application of non-toxic antifreeze in critical lines to ensure absolute protection against expansion.

Winter Chemical Kit

Professional dose of winterizing algaecide and stain inhibitors to keep the water clear until the spring opening.

Water Level Drawdown

Lowering the pool level below the tiles or skimmers to prevent water from entering the plumbing during heavy rains or ice expansion.

Cover Security Check

We verify all springs, anchors, or water bags are perfectly tensioned to withstand the Las Vegas winter wind and debris without shifting.

Seasonal Pool Care: The Best Way To Close Your Pool

Keeping your pool in top shape means performing routine cleanings, as well as deep cleans and seasonal care. When many people think of Las Vegas, winter does not often come to mind. Even without heavy snow fall, Nevada does experience drops in temperature that can lead to damaged pools. Instead of waiting for a worse-case scenario, taking a preventative approach to pool care is a great step toward prolonging the lifespan of your swim space.

Treating Pool Water: During swimming or pool season, the chemical levels of your water are of great importance, but when the weather cools down, property owners tend to forget about their water condition. If your water system is going to be sitting idle for long periods, it is important to add chemicals now and then to avoid being overrun with algae or invasive growth. In addition to caring for your chemical balance, it is important to keep an eye on your water level, as well. During the spring and summer months, the water level of your pool should be up above your skimmer line, allowing water to enter. During winter, the proper level is a few inches below the skimmer to avoid water access, and damage to sensitive areas, like pumps, motors, and lines.

Swap Your Pool Cover: During warmer months, it is a good idea to have a mesh pool cover over your system. A mesh design allows sunlight to get in, warming water and reducing utility costs associated with running a heater. A winter cover, on the other hand, is solid and reduces the amount of light that can reach water, which helps to reduce algae growth.

Inspect Structures & Mechanisms: Having a trained eye inspect your system can help to reduce the risk of costly damage. A small tear in the pool liner can be patched readily, but when these turn into large scale rips, it can lead to extensive damage and the need for expensive repairs. By inspecting liners and tiles, it is possible to spot problems before they turn into full blown disasters. Once water levels are dropped, it is always a good idea to remove detachable pieces, dry them and store them until spring comes back around.

Las Vegas Pool Closing: Frequently Asked Questions

When should I close my pool for the winter in Las Vegas?

It is best to wait until the water temperature has dropped and stayed cool. Closing too early during a warm Nevada autumn can allow algae to grow under the cover, leading to a much more difficult opening next spring.

Is 'winterizing' pipes necessary for pools in Las Vegas, NV?

Absolutely. Even a brief cold snap can freeze stagnant water in your plumbing. Puddle Pools uses high-pressure air to 'blow out' the lines and installs specialized winter plugs to protect your underground pipes from cracking.

What chemicals are used to winterize a pool in Nevada?

A proper Las Vegas closing requires a combination of long-lasting algaecide and sequestering agents to prevent staining. This protects your pool surface from mineral scale and organic growth during the long off-season.

Should I lower the water level in my pool for the winter?

Yes, we typically lower the water level below the skimmer mouth to protect the plastic components from ice expansion. Our team ensures the level is perfectly balanced to support your cover while keeping the structure stable.
